Spokane ACT Tutoring FAQ
For high school students, taking the American College Testing (ACT) exam is just one step in a journey to finding the college that could help them to meet their life goals. The ACT is one of a handful of frequently used admissions exams that colleges use to evaluate whether a student could fit into their school. The standard exam has four sections, and you can choose to complete an additional writing section. Students seeking ACT tutoring in Spokane, WA, can get assistance in locating an independent tutor from Varsity Tutors.
The five sections of the ACT are English, Math, Reading, Science, and Writing, although the writing section is optional. Without the writing prompt, there are a total of 225 multiple-choice questions. Each subject area has its own set of rules for the test, and each section has a time limit. The science section is 35 minutes, the reading section is 35 minutes, the English section is 45 minutes, and the math section is 60 minutes. Your composite score on the ACT will range from 1-36, and it is important that you answer as many questions as you can, because you aren't penalized for incorrect answers. You could only receive points for correct answers.
